| Hi, I have developed a site on my home machine. I have made changes to the database. I am now ready to move the entire site to production on the server. My question is, how do I move the database over. I was thinking that if I hadn’t made any changes to the DB then I would just run the installation of OSC again and then replace the php files. But since I have made changes to the DB I am not sure how I can go about this. Also what is the best way to go in terms of the set up for your development system to make things easy when moving to production? Thanks |
